| Course contents : | Justification of fundamental assumptions in the case of incompressible thin films. Equation of Stokes, of dissipation and finally description of basic Reynolds equation. Numerical methods of treatment. Special problems like: Field of temperatures in steady-state regime, field of pressures and shaft trajectories during a non-stationary cycle (engine rods), problems of instability in journal bearings, squeeze films hydrostatic of incompressible fluids, elastohydrodynamic, rheology of greases and porous bearings. Resolution of problems. |
 |
| Course objective : | Overview of the various types of bearings and lubrication modes: hydrodynamic, hydrostatic and elastohydrodynamic, as well in stationary regime as in non-stationary. Study of basic rheology of greases. |
